Our take

Doamne Ajuta is a fragrance for the person who wants a garden scent without the polite restraint that usually comes with it. The opening gives you strawberry and black currant, but the basil and pink pepper push the fruit into a sharp, green space. Tomato leaf adds a damp, crushed-stem edge that keeps the first impression from leaning into a standard fruity spray. It feels alive and a little untamed, which is exactly the point.

The heart moves toward jasmine, orange blossom, and rose, yet the tomato note remains present. Violet settles in beside them and pulls the flowers toward something powdery and soft. This stage trades the bright bite of the start for a lush, slightly humid density. The floral side is not clean or soapy, and the greenery stops it from becoming a simple bouquet.

The drydown is where the argument settles. Musk and sandalwood wrap the remaining tomato and violet in a smooth, creamy base. Vetiver adds a dry, earthy thread that keeps the woods from feeling too polished. The sweetness from the opening fruit lingers here as a mild, musky sugar. It is a calm, grounding finish that feels intimate and slightly nostalgic.

This closing mix of powdery white florals, woody vetiver, and soft musk creates a scent that fits a cool morning walk through damp soil. The green and aromatic accords stay close to the skin, carried by that gentle sandalwood.
